Things are looking up for the Roslyn High School Bulldogs.

Last Saturday, the Bulldogs rebounded from a loss to Island Trees to defeat Westbury, 18-8.

The win upped Roslyn's record to 2-4 in Conference III play.

The Bulldogs' victory was built on the backs of a potent running offense and solid defensive play. Both Lydell Wilson and Adam Kaplan rushed for over 100 yards, while quarterback John Combs rushed for 51 yards. Combs also passed for 122 yards on seven completed passes.

Combs got the Bulldogs on the scoreboard in the second quarter with a 12-yard touchdown run.

In the second half, Luke Song's 19-yard run gave the Bulldogs a 12-0 lead they would never relinquish. Kaplan's one-yard scoring run in the fourth quarter closed out the scoring.

Also starring for the Bulldogs was Matthew Liebhaber, who had five catches for 97 yards. Both Wilson and Liebhaber had nine tackles each to spear the Bulldogs' stingy defense.
